Does Netanyahu really want Trump's peace plan for Gaza?

Benjamin Netanyahu shook Donald Trump's hand and smiled as the president announced his new 20-point peace plan for Gaza. So, everything was looking good! But no, not really. Netanyahu had to agree to the deal but he knows that it will never get past his most extreme conservative cabinet members who want Gaza to become an extension to the West Bank for Jewish settlers. Nor will Hamas leap at it because they will demand that all Israeli troops are withdrawn from Gaza and Netanyahu is never gong to agree to that. So, lots of optimistic welcome from around the world to the Trump deal but are they all really fooling themselves? This latest deal is an agglomeration of all the previous deals and since every one failed to bring the war to an end, it is pretty short odds that this 20-pointer will also go the same way. Or if it does work, eventually, it will be a long way off. Netanyahu is against a two-state solution, ie an indpendent state for Palestinians, but the Trump proposal hints at it, in order to keep the Arab nations happy. But there is nothing in the package that says it will definitely happen or how it will happen. One thing that does seem to have been dropped is Trump's idea of turning Gaza into a Middle East Riviera, with all the Palestinians told to leave and live somewhere else. That means the Palestinian inhabitants of what's left of Gaza will be allowed to stay, as the massive reconstruction programme gets underway. If this deal goes ahead, Netanyahu will not survive as Israeli leader.
